What are the key skills and qualifications needed to thrive as a from home Python bioinformatics professional?

To thrive as a From Home Python Bioinformatics professional, you need strong programming skills in Python, a solid background in biology or bioinformatics, and at least a bachelor's degree in a related field. Familiarity with bioinformatics tools (such as Biopython, BLAST, and genome analysis platforms), version control systems like Git, and relevant data analysis libraries is crucial. Excellent problem-solving abilities, attention to detail, and self-motivation are essential soft skills for managing complex projects independently. These competencies enable effective analysis of biological data, accurate interpretation of results, and efficient collaboration in remote or distributed research environments.

What is a from home Python bioinformatics job?

A From Home Python Bioinformatics job involves working remotely to analyze and interpret biological data using Python programming. Professionals in this role apply computational techniques to solve problems in genomics, proteomics, and other areas of biology. They often write scripts or develop software to process large datasets, automate workflows, and visualize results for scientific research. These jobs typically require knowledge of both biology and computer science, as well as experience with relevant bioinformatics tools and libraries. Remote positions allow for flexible work arrangements, making it possible to collaborate with research teams from anywhere.

Job description

Natera is seeking a Senior Bioinformatics Scientist to join our Bioinformatics team dedicated to early cancer detection. As a core member of the Research and Development department, you will play a pivotal role in designing and implementing innovative computational solutions. The ideal candidate possesses a robust background in algorithm development, high-throughput biological data analysis, and scalable pipeline architecture. We are looking for a versatile professional capable of thriving as an individual contributor, a collaborative co-developer, and a key participant in large-scale, cross-departmental initiatives. In this role, you will develop novel algorithms and pipelines while analyzing complex genomic datasets to advance the frontiers of early-stage cancer diagnostics.
PRIMARY RESPONSIBILITIES:

  • Innovate, design, develop, and validate advanced algorithms and statistical models to extract actionable insights from large-scale genomic datasets for early cancer detection.
  • Co-architect, implement, and deploy automated analysis workflows for clinical diagnostics, ensuring robust performance for variant calling, fusion detection, and automated quality control.
  • Contribute to rigorous code reviews, maintain comprehensive technical documentation, and drive the continuous optimization of core computational infrastructure.
  • Analyze complex multi-omic data using high-performance internal pipelines, collaborating closely with wet-lab scientists and statisticians to meet critical research milestones.

QUALIFICATIONS:

  • PhD in Bioinformatics, Computer Science, Engineering, Statistics, Cancer Biology or similar field
  • 0-3 years of professional or postgraduate experience in bioinformatics or computational biology.

KNOWLEDGE, SKILLS AND ABILITIES:

  • Excellent communication skills with a demonstrated ability to present complex computational findings to diverse cross-functional stakeholders.
  • Deep expertise in high-throughput DNA sequencing (NGS) analysis, including sequence alignment, mapping, and clinical-grade variant calling.
  • A proven track record of developing state-of-the-art, high-impact bioinformatics methodologies.
  • Advanced knowledge of data structures, algorithm design, and computational complexity analysis.
  • High proficiency in Python and its scientific ecosystem (NumPy, Pandas, Scikit-learn) for data manipulation and automation.
  • Experience with workflow orchestration languages (WDL preferred) for building and versioning scalable bioinformatics pipelines.
  • Experience with cloud-based distributed computing environments, specifically AWS.
  • Familiarity with contemporary analytical techniques and biomarkers in cancer biology.
  • Working knowledge of public genomic databases such as TCGA, COSMIC, or OncoKB.
  • Proficiency in Linux environments, including command-line tools and shell scripting.
